Montebello, CA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Montebello?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Montebello Studio Apartments | $1,881 | $1,595 | $2,500 |
Montebello 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,081 | $1,650 | $2,539 |
| Montebello 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,492 | $2,100 | $3,095 |
| Montebello 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,238 | $2,400 | $4,120 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Montebello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Montebello with 1 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Montebello is at Rivera Gardens listed at $1,775.
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Montebello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Montebello is $2,081.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Montebello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Montebello is a 900 square feet unit starting from $2,100 at Downey Pointe Apartments.
What is the average size for Montebello 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Montebello is currently 512 sq ft.
